OLDBOY (2013) follows the story of an advertising executive (Josh Brolin) who is kidnapped and held hostage for twenty years in solitary confinement without any indication of his captor’s motive. When he is inexplicably released, he embarks on an obsessive mission to discover who orchestrated his bizarre and torturous punishment only to find he is still trapped in a web of conspiracy and torment. His quest for revenge leads him into an ill-fated relationship with a young social worker (Elizabeth Olsen) and ultimately to an illusive man (Sharlto Copley) who allegedly holds the key to his salvation.


OLDBOY directed by Spike Lee ("Inside Man"), from a screenplay written by Mark Protosevich. The cast includes: Samuel L. Jackson, Josh Brolin, Elizabeth Olsen, Sharlto Copley, Rami Malek, Hannah Simone, Lance Reddick, Richard Portnow and Michael Imperioli. It opens in theaters October 25th, 2013.
